OFFICIALESE
n. Derog. Language characteristic of official documents.
OMNIPRESENT
adj. Present everywhere. omnipresence n. [latin: related to *present1]
OPENANDSHUT
adj. Straightforward.
OPENHEARTED
adj. Frank and kindly.
OPENINGTIME
n. Time at which public houses may legally open for custom.
OPENMOUTHED
adj. Aghast with surprise.
OPERATIONAL
adj. - of or engaged in or used for operations.

- able or ready to function. operationally adv.

- research n. The application of scientific principles to business etc. Management.
OPINIONATED
adj. Dogmatic in one's opinions.
OPPORTUNISM
n. Adaptation of one's policy or judgement to circumstances or opportunity, esp. Regardless of principle. opportunist n. Opportunistic adj. Opportunistically adv.
OPPORTUNITY
n. (pl. -ies) favourable chance or opening offered by circumstances.
